A Chance for Teens to Share Experiences

Families are diverse, and so are the teenage members of those families. This is a gathering for teens who have a personal experience with adoption, third-party reproduction, or foster care. They will have a chance to share stories and learn from each other in a safe environment.

When: Oct. 3, Nov. 7, or Dec. 5, from 7:30-9 p.m.
Where: Center for Integrative Health and Healing, 13001 Seal Beach Blvd., Suite 360, Seal Beach, CA 90740
Cost: Suggested $10 donation
